Welcome to the forum
Since business credit is different than personal credit
Things to know:
HP's carry no weight in business scoring so you could apply all you want and as much as you want
Doesn't mean you'll be approved but won't hurt you either on your business file Lol
There's no limit to how many TL's you can have..... loans, CC, other
Now you speak of personal issues? This could be a problem because in most cases you will have to do a PG to be approved for business CC's from major banks
Meaning approval will be based off your personal credit scores/files
